Dental Assistant Salary in Alabama

The median dental assistant salary in Alabama is $36,984 per year, which is 13% below the national median of $42,510.

Dental Assistant Salary in Alabama by Experience

In Alabama, an entry-level dental assistant earns around $26,970, while experienced professionals earn up to $50,460 per year. The cost of living index in Alabama is 87% of the national average.

Entry Level (0-2 yrs)
$26,970
$-4,030 vs national
Mid Level (3-7 yrs)
$37,410
$-5,590 vs national
Senior Level (8+ yrs)
$50,460
$-7,540 vs national

Salary Percentiles in Alabama

Percentile AL Salary
10th Percentile $26,100
25th Percentile $30,450
Median (50th) $36,984
75th Percentile $45,240
90th Percentile $52,200

Job Outlook in Alabama

Nationally, dental assistant employment is projected to grow 8% over the next decade (faster than average). Alabama's demand may vary based on local industry trends.
